<h2>What are effective disease resistance strategies for Beefsteak Tomatoes?</h2>
<p>Effective disease resistance strategies for Beefsteak tomatoes include implementing crop rotation, selecting resistant varieties, employing integrated pest management, improving soil health, and using proper watering techniques. These methods collectively enhance the plants&#8217; resilience against various diseases and pests, ensuring healthier yields.</p>
<h3>Crop rotation</h3>
<p>Crop rotation involves alternating the types of crops grown in a specific area each season. For Beefsteak tomatoes, rotating with non-solanaceous crops can disrupt the life cycles of soil-borne pathogens and pests. Aim for a rotation period of at least three years before replanting tomatoes in the same spot.</p>
<h3>Resistant varieties</h3>
<p>Selecting disease-resistant Beefsteak tomato varieties is a proactive strategy to minimize disease risks. Look for seeds labeled with resistance to common diseases such as Fusarium wilt and Verticillium wilt. These varieties can significantly reduce the need for chemical treatments and improve overall plant health.</p>
<h3>Integrated pest management</h3>
<p>Integrated pest management (IPM) combines biological, cultural, and chemical practices to control pests effectively. For Beefsteak tomatoes, this might include introducing beneficial insects, using traps, and applying organic pesticides only when necessary. Regular monitoring of pest populations helps in making informed decisions about interventions.</p>
<h3>Soil health improvement</h3>
<p>Enhancing soil health is crucial for growing resilient Beefsteak tomatoes. Incorporate organic matter, such as compost or well-rotted manure, to improve soil structure and nutrient availability. Regular soil testing can help determine pH and nutrient levels, guiding amendments to create optimal growing conditions.</p>
<h3>Proper watering techniques</h3>
<p>Proper watering techniques are essential to prevent diseases like blossom end rot and root rot in Beefsteak tomatoes. Water deeply and infrequently to encourage deep root growth, aiming for about 1-2 inches of water per week. Avoid overhead watering to reduce humidity around the foliage, which can promote fungal diseases.</p>

<h2>What are common diseases affecting Beefsteak Tomatoes?</h2>
<p>Beefsteak tomatoes are susceptible to several diseases that can significantly impact yield and quality. Understanding these common diseases helps growers implement effective management strategies to protect their crops.</p>
<h3>Blight</h3>
<p>Blight, particularly late blight, is a serious fungal disease that can devastate beefsteak tomato plants. It thrives in cool, moist conditions and can spread rapidly, leading to dark spots on leaves and fruit rot.</p>
<p>To manage blight, practice crop rotation and ensure good air circulation around plants. Applying fungicides at the first sign of infection can also help mitigate damage. Regularly inspect plants for symptoms and remove any affected foliage promptly.</p>
<h3>Powdery mildew</h3>
<p>Powdery mildew is a fungal disease characterized by a white, powdery coating on leaves and stems. It typically occurs in warm, dry conditions and can stunt growth and reduce fruit quality.</p>
<p>To prevent powdery mildew, ensure adequate spacing between plants for airflow and avoid overhead watering. If detected, fungicides can be effective, but early intervention is crucial to prevent widespread infection.</p>
<h3>Fusarium wilt</h3>
<p>Fusarium wilt is caused by a soil-borne fungus that affects the vascular system of beefsteak tomatoes, leading to wilting and yellowing of leaves. This disease is particularly challenging because it can persist in the soil for years.</p>
<p>To combat Fusarium wilt, select resistant tomato varieties and practice crop rotation with non-host plants. Soil solarization can also help reduce fungal populations in the soil. Regularly monitor plants for early signs of wilting and take action immediately to limit spread.</p>

<h2>What soil types are best for growing Roma tomatoes in the United States?</h2>
<p>Roma tomatoes thrive in specific soil types that enhance their growth and fruit production. The best soils for cultivating these tomatoes are loamy, sandy, and clay soils, provided they are well-drained and have a balanced pH level.</p>
<h3>Loamy soil</h3>
<p>Loamy soil is often considered the ideal choice for growing Roma tomatoes due to its balanced composition of sand, silt, and clay. This type of soil retains moisture while allowing excess water to drain, preventing root rot. Aim for a loamy soil that is rich in organic matter to promote healthy growth and robust fruiting.</p>
<p>To enhance loamy soil, incorporate compost or well-rotted manure before planting. This not only improves nutrient content but also boosts soil structure, making it easier for roots to penetrate and access water and nutrients.</p>
<h3>Sandy soil</h3>
<p>Sandy soil can be beneficial for Roma tomatoes if it is well-drained, as it warms up quickly in spring, allowing for earlier planting. However, sandy soil tends to drain water rapidly, which can lead to nutrient leaching. To counteract this, regularly amend sandy soil with organic matter to improve its moisture retention and nutrient-holding capacity.</p>
<p>Consider using mulch around your plants to help retain soil moisture and reduce evaporation, especially in hotter climates. This practice can significantly enhance the growing conditions for your Roma tomatoes.</p>
<h3>Clay soil</h3>
<p>Clay soil is dense and can retain moisture, which can be both an advantage and a disadvantage for Roma tomatoes. While it holds water well, it may also lead to poor drainage, risking root rot. If you have clay soil, consider mixing in organic matter and sand to improve drainage and aeration.</p>
<p>Regular tilling can help break up compacted clay, making it easier for roots to grow. Adding gypsum can also improve soil structure, allowing for better water infiltration and root development.</p>
<h3>Well-drained soil</h3>
<p>Well-drained soil is crucial for the successful growth of Roma tomatoes, as it prevents waterlogging and encourages healthy root systems. Regardless of the soil type, ensure that water can flow freely through the soil. This can be achieved by incorporating organic materials and avoiding heavy compaction.</p>
<p>To test drainage, dig a hole and fill it with water; if it drains within a few hours, your soil is likely well-drained. If not, consider raised beds or amending the soil to improve drainage before planting.</p>
<h3>pH-balanced soil</h3>
<p>Roma tomatoes prefer a pH level between 6.0 and 6.8 for optimal growth. Soil that is too acidic or too alkaline can hinder nutrient absorption and affect plant health. Testing your soil&#8217;s pH can help you determine if adjustments are necessary.</p>
<p>If your soil is too acidic, adding lime can raise the pH, while sulfur can lower it if the soil is too alkaline. Regular monitoring and adjustment will help maintain the ideal pH balance for thriving Roma tomatoes.</p>

<h2>What are the common soil amendments for Roma tomatoes?</h2>
<p>Common soil amendments for Roma tomatoes include organic materials that enhance soil fertility and structure. These amendments improve drainage, nutrient availability, and overall plant health, which are crucial for robust tomato growth.</p>
<h3>Compost</h3>
<p>Compost is a rich organic amendment that provides essential nutrients to Roma tomatoes. It improves soil structure, enhances moisture retention, and encourages beneficial microbial activity. Incorporating well-decomposed compost into the soil before planting can significantly boost tomato yields.</p>
<p>To use compost effectively, mix it into the top 15-20 cm of soil at a rate of about 2-4 kg per square meter. This ensures that the nutrients are readily available to the plants during their growth cycle.</p>
<h3>Bone meal</h3>
<p>Bone meal is a slow-release source of phosphorus and calcium, which are vital for root development and fruiting in Roma tomatoes. It helps strengthen the plant&#8217;s structure and supports healthy flowering and fruit set.</p>
<p>Apply bone meal at a rate of approximately 100-200 grams per square meter when preparing the soil. This will provide a steady supply of nutrients as the tomatoes grow, promoting robust plant health.</p>
<h3>Peat moss</h3>
<p>Peat moss is an excellent amendment for improving soil aeration and moisture retention, making it beneficial for growing Roma tomatoes. It helps create a loose, well-draining soil environment that is ideal for root expansion.</p>
<p>Incorporate peat moss into the soil at a rate of about 1-2 kg per square meter. However, be cautious with its use, as it can lower soil pH; consider testing soil acidity and adjusting accordingly.</p>
<h3>Perlite</h3>
<p>Perlite is a lightweight volcanic glass that enhances soil drainage and aeration, making it a valuable amendment for Roma tomatoes. It prevents soil compaction and allows roots to access oxygen more easily, which is crucial for healthy growth.</p>
<p>Mix perlite into the soil at a ratio of about 10-20% by volume. This helps maintain optimal moisture levels without waterlogging, ensuring that the roots remain healthy and productive.</p>

<h2>What climate conditions are ideal for growing tomatoes?</h2>
<p>Tomatoes thrive in warm climates with specific temperature and humidity ranges. Ideal conditions include warm temperatures and consistent humidity to promote healthy growth and fruit production.</p>
<h3>Warm temperatures between 70°F and 85°F</h3>
<p>Tomatoes flourish best in temperatures ranging from 70°F to 85°F (21°C to 29°C). Within this range, plants can efficiently photosynthesize and develop fruit. Extreme temperatures, either too low or too high, can hinder growth and reduce yields.</p>
<p>During cooler nights, temperatures should ideally stay above 55°F (13°C) to prevent blossom drop. Conversely, if temperatures exceed 90°F (32°C) during the day, it can lead to poor pollination and fruit set.</p>
<h3>Consistent humidity levels around 60% to 70%</h3>
<p>Maintaining humidity levels between 60% and 70% is crucial for healthy tomato plants. This range helps prevent issues like blossom end rot and encourages optimal nutrient uptake. High humidity can also promote fungal diseases, so balance is key.</p>
<p>To manage humidity, consider using mulch to retain soil moisture and reduce evaporation. If growing indoors or in a greenhouse, monitor humidity levels regularly to ensure they remain within the ideal range.</p>
<p><img loading="lazy" decoding="async" style="max-width:100%;height:auto;" alt="How does temperature affect tomato growth?" src="/wp-content/uploads/how-does-temperature-affect-tomato-growth-2.webp" /></p>
<h2>How does temperature affect tomato growth?</h2>
<p>Temperature significantly influences tomato growth, as it affects germination, development, and overall yield. Maintaining the right temperature range is crucial for healthy plants and maximizing production.</p>
<h3>Optimal germination at 70°F to 90°F</h3>
<p>Tomato seeds germinate best when soil temperatures are between 70°F and 90°F. Within this range, seeds typically sprout within a week to ten days, leading to strong seedlings. For optimal results, consider using heat mats to maintain consistent temperatures if outdoor conditions are cooler.</p>
<p>Once germination occurs, maintaining warm temperatures will support robust early growth. Aim for daytime temperatures around 75°F to 85°F and slightly cooler nights to encourage healthy development.</p>
<h3>Growth stunted below 50°F</h3>
<p>When temperatures drop below 50°F, tomato plants experience stunted growth and may even suffer from stress. Prolonged exposure to cold can lead to poor fruit set and increased susceptibility to diseases. If nighttime temperatures are forecasted to fall below this threshold, consider using row covers or cloches to protect your plants.</p>
<p>Additionally, avoid planting tomatoes too early in the season to prevent exposure to chilly conditions. Wait until soil temperatures consistently reach at least 60°F to ensure better establishment and growth.</p>

<h2>What are common soil amendments for heirloom tomatoes?</h2>
<p>Common soil amendments for heirloom tomatoes include bone meal, wood ash, and gypsum. These amendments enhance soil fertility by providing essential nutrients that promote healthy growth and fruit production.</p>
<h3>Bone meal for phosphorus</h3>
<p>Bone meal is a rich source of phosphorus, which is crucial for root development and flowering in heirloom tomatoes. When adding bone meal, aim for a rate of about 1 to 2 cups per 10 square feet of garden space, mixing it well into the soil before planting.</p>
<p>Phosphorus helps tomatoes establish a strong root system and encourages early fruiting. Be cautious not to overapply, as excessive phosphorus can lead to nutrient imbalances in the soil.</p>
<h3>Wood ash for potassium</h3>
<p>Wood ash provides potassium, an essential nutrient that enhances fruit quality and overall plant health. Use wood ash sparingly, about 1 to 2 cups per 10 square feet, and ensure it is well-distributed in the soil.</p>
<p>Potassium helps tomatoes resist diseases and improves their ability to withstand drought. Avoid using ash from treated wood, as it may contain harmful chemicals that can affect plant growth.</p>
<h3>Gypsum for calcium</h3>
<p>Gypsum is an effective amendment for adding calcium to the soil, which is vital for preventing blossom end rot in heirloom tomatoes. Incorporate gypsum at a rate of around 1 to 2 cups per 10 square feet, mixing it into the topsoil.</p>
<p>Calcium supports cell wall structure and overall plant vigor. Regular testing of soil pH can help determine if additional calcium is needed, as it works best in slightly acidic to neutral soils.</p>

<h2>What are the key differences between heirloom and hybrid tomatoes?</h2>
<p>Heirloom tomatoes are traditional varieties that have been passed down through generations, while hybrid tomatoes are created through controlled breeding for specific characteristics. Understanding these differences can help beginners choose the right type for their gardening needs.</p>
<h3>Heirloom tomatoes are open-pollinated</h3>
<p>Heirloom tomatoes are open-pollinated, meaning they are pollinated naturally by wind, insects, or other natural means. This allows them to maintain their genetic traits over time, resulting in a stable variety that can be replanted year after year.</p>
<p>These tomatoes often come from a single parent variety and are typically at least 50 years old. They offer a diverse range of colors, shapes, and flavors, making them popular among home gardeners looking for unique options.</p>
<h3>Hybrid tomatoes are bred for specific traits</h3>
<p>Hybrid tomatoes are developed through controlled breeding to enhance specific traits such as disease resistance, yield, and uniformity. This means that they often perform better in certain conditions, making them a reliable choice for beginners.</p>
<p>However, hybrids do not breed true from seed, meaning that if you save seeds from a hybrid tomato, the next generation may not exhibit the same desirable traits. This can be a consideration for those interested in seed saving.</p>
<h3>Flavor profiles vary significantly</h3>
<p>Heirloom tomatoes are renowned for their rich and complex flavors, often described as superior to many hybrids. The diverse genetics of heirlooms contribute to a wide range of taste experiences, from sweet to tangy.</p>
<p>In contrast, hybrid tomatoes are often bred for consistency and shelf-life, which can sometimes result in a more bland flavor. Beginners may want to try a few heirloom varieties to experience the difference in taste firsthand.</p>
<h3>Seed saving practices differ</h3>
<p>With heirloom tomatoes, gardeners can save seeds from their best plants and expect them to produce similar plants in the next generation. This practice is not only cost-effective but also encourages biodiversity.</p>
<p>In contrast, saving seeds from hybrid tomatoes is generally discouraged, as the resulting plants may not retain the desired traits. For beginners, focusing on heirlooms can be a rewarding way to engage with gardening and sustainability.</p>

<h2>What are the common tomato pests in the United States?</h2>
<p>Common tomato pests in the United States include various insects that can significantly affect plant health and yield. Identifying these pests early is crucial for effective management and prevention strategies.</p>
<h3>Tomato hornworm</h3>
<p>The tomato hornworm is a large caterpillar that can devastate tomato plants by consuming leaves and fruit. These pests are typically green with white stripes and can grow up to 4 inches long.</p>
<p>To manage hornworms, regularly inspect plants for signs of damage or the presence of the caterpillars. Handpicking them off plants is an effective control method, or consider using organic insecticides if infestations are severe.</p>
<h3>Spider mites</h3>
<p>Spider mites are tiny arachnids that thrive in hot, dry conditions and can cause significant damage to tomato plants by sucking out plant juices. Infestations often lead to yellowing leaves and fine webbing on the undersides of leaves.</p>
<p>To control spider mites, maintain adequate humidity and regularly spray plants with water to dislodge them. Insecticidal soaps or miticides can also be effective if the problem persists.</p>
<h3>Whiteflies</h3>
<p>Whiteflies are small, white flying insects that feed on the sap of tomato plants, leading to yellowing leaves and stunted growth. They can also transmit viral diseases, making them particularly harmful.</p>
<p>To combat whiteflies, use yellow sticky traps to monitor and reduce their population. Additionally, introducing natural predators like ladybugs can help keep their numbers in check.</p>
<h3>Aphids</h3>
<p>Aphids are small, soft-bodied insects that cluster on new growth and undersides of leaves, sucking sap and weakening the plant. They can reproduce rapidly, leading to significant infestations.</p>
<p>Regularly inspect plants for aphids and consider using insecticidal soap or neem oil for control. Encouraging beneficial insects, such as lacewings, can also help manage aphid populations naturally.</p>
<h3>Flea beetles</h3>
<p>Flea beetles are small, jumping insects that create tiny holes in tomato leaves, which can stunt growth and reduce yields. They are particularly problematic in young plants and can be identified by their characteristic jumping behavior when disturbed.</p>
<p>To protect your tomatoes from flea beetles, use row covers early in the season and apply insecticidal dust if necessary. Crop rotation and maintaining healthy soil can also reduce their impact over time.</p>

<h2>What is the ideal soil pH level for tomatoes?</h2>
<p>The ideal soil pH level for tomatoes ranges from 6.0 to 6.8. Maintaining this pH range is crucial for optimal growth, as it influences nutrient availability and overall plant health.</p>
<h3>Optimal pH range: 6.0 to 6.8</h3>
<p>Tomatoes thrive best in slightly acidic soil, specifically within the pH range of 6.0 to 6.8. This level promotes healthy root development and maximizes nutrient uptake. Soil that is too acidic (below 6.0) or too alkaline (above 6.8) can hinder growth and lead to deficiencies.</p>
<p>To achieve the ideal pH, consider testing your soil before planting. If adjustments are needed, adding lime can raise pH, while sulfur can help lower it.</p>
<h3>Impact of pH on nutrient availability</h3>
<p>The pH level of soil significantly affects the availability of essential nutrients for tomatoes. For instance, nutrients like nitrogen, phosphorus, and potassium are most accessible within the ideal pH range. Outside this range, certain nutrients may become locked in the soil, making them unavailable to plants.</p>
<p>For example, at a pH below 6.0, micronutrients such as iron may become overly soluble, leading to toxicity, while at a pH above 6.8, nutrients like phosphorus can become less available. Regular monitoring of soil pH helps prevent these issues.</p>
<h3>Testing soil pH with kits</h3>
<p>Testing soil pH is straightforward with commercially available soil pH kits. These kits typically include a pH meter or test strips that provide quick results. Follow the manufacturer&#8217;s instructions for accurate readings, usually requiring a soil sample mixed with distilled water.</p>
<p>For best results, test your soil in multiple locations within your garden, as pH can vary. Conduct tests at least once a year, ideally before planting, to ensure your tomatoes have the best growing conditions.</p>
<p><img loading="lazy" decoding="async" style="max-width:100%;height:auto;" alt="How to adjust soil pH for tomatoes?" src="/wp-content/uploads/how-to-adjust-soil-ph-for-tomatoes-2.webp" /></p>
<h2>How to adjust soil pH for tomatoes?</h2>
<p>To adjust soil pH for tomatoes, test your soil to determine its current pH level, then use appropriate amendments to raise or lower the pH as needed. Tomatoes thrive best in slightly acidic to neutral soil, ideally between 6.0 and 7.0 pH.</p>
<h3>Using lime to raise pH</h3>
<p>Lime is a common amendment used to raise soil pH, making it less acidic. When applying lime, consider using agricultural lime (calcium carbonate) or dolomitic lime, which also adds magnesium.</p>
<p>To determine how much lime to use, conduct a soil test. Generally, applying 1 to 2 tons of lime per acre can effectively raise pH, but this may vary based on initial soil conditions. Incorporate lime into the top 6 inches of soil for best results.</p>
<h3>Using sulfur to lower pH</h3>
<p>To lower soil pH, elemental sulfur is often used. When soil bacteria oxidize sulfur, it produces sulfuric acid, which decreases pH levels. This process can take several weeks, so plan accordingly.</p>
<p>A typical recommendation is to apply 0.5 to 1 ton of sulfur per acre, depending on how much you need to lower the pH. It&#8217;s essential to mix the sulfur into the soil to enhance its effectiveness and monitor pH changes over time.</p>
<h3>Organic amendments for pH adjustment</h3>
<p>Organic materials such as compost, peat moss, or pine needles can also help adjust soil pH. These amendments not only modify pH but also improve soil structure and nutrient content.</p>
<p>For instance, adding well-decomposed compost can gradually lower pH while enriching the soil. Aim for a mix of 20-30% organic material in your soil to achieve a balanced nutrient profile and optimal pH for tomatoes.</p>

<h2>What nutrients do tomatoes need for optimal growth?</h2>
<p>Tomatoes require a balanced mix of nutrients for optimal growth, including macronutrients like nitrogen, phosphorus, and potassium, as well as essential micronutrients. Ensuring the right nutrient levels can significantly enhance fruit quality and yield.</p>
<h3>Key nutrients: nitrogen, phosphorus, potassium</h3>
<p>Nitrogen is crucial for leafy growth and overall plant vigor, while phosphorus supports root development and flowering. Potassium plays a vital role in fruit quality and disease resistance. A balanced fertilizer with an N-P-K ratio of around 5-10-10 is often recommended for tomatoes.</p>
<p>Regular soil testing can help determine the specific nutrient needs of your soil. Adjusting fertilizer applications based on these tests can optimize nutrient uptake and improve tomato health.</p>
<h3>Importance of calcium and magnesium</h3>
<p>Calcium is essential for cell wall structure and helps prevent blossom end rot, a common issue in tomatoes. Magnesium aids in photosynthesis and contributes to overall plant health. Incorporating lime or gypsum can effectively increase calcium levels, while Epsom salt can provide magnesium.</p>
<p>Maintaining adequate levels of these nutrients is particularly important during the fruiting stage. Regular monitoring and amendments can help ensure that tomatoes receive the necessary support for strong growth.</p>
<h3>Micronutrients for tomato health</h3>
<p>Micronutrients such as iron, manganese, and zinc are vital for tomato health, albeit in smaller quantities. These elements contribute to various physiological functions, including chlorophyll production and enzyme activity. A deficiency in any of these can lead to poor growth and reduced yields.</p>
<p>Using a balanced fertilizer that includes micronutrients or applying foliar sprays can help address deficiencies. Observing plant symptoms, such as yellowing leaves or stunted growth, can guide timely interventions to maintain nutrient balance.</p>

<h2>What is the importance of soil drainage for tomatoes?</h2>
<p>Soil drainage is crucial for tomato plants as it affects their root health and overall growth. Proper drainage prevents waterlogging, which can lead to root rot and nutrient deficiencies.</p>
<h3>Effects of poor drainage on root health</h3>
<p>Poor drainage can suffocate tomato roots by limiting their access to oxygen, leading to stunted growth and increased susceptibility to diseases. When roots are submerged in waterlogged soil, they may begin to decay, which can severely impact the plant&#8217;s ability to absorb nutrients and water.</p>
<p>Additionally, nutrient leaching can occur in poorly drained soils, causing an imbalance in essential elements like nitrogen, phosphorus, and potassium. This nutrient imbalance can result in poor fruit development and lower yields.</p>
<h3>Signs of waterlogged soil</h3>
<p>Waterlogged soil often presents visible signs such as standing water, a spongy texture, and a sour smell. If the soil remains wet for extended periods, you may notice yellowing leaves or wilting plants, indicating that the roots are struggling.</p>
<p>Another sign is the presence of moss or algae on the soil surface, which thrives in overly moist conditions. Checking the soil moisture with a simple finger test can also help; if it feels consistently wet several inches down, drainage may be inadequate.</p>
<h3>Best practices for improving drainage</h3>
<p>To enhance soil drainage for tomatoes, consider incorporating organic matter like compost or well-rotted manure, which improves soil structure and aeration. Raised beds can also be beneficial, as they elevate the root zone, allowing excess water to drain away more effectively.</p>
<p>Regularly aerating the soil by tilling or using a garden fork can help break up compacted layers, promoting better water movement. Additionally, installing drainage tiles or creating swales can redirect excess water away from tomato plants.</p>
